Gallaudet vs. NewU

Both Gallaudet University and NewU University are Private, 4 years schools located in District of Columbia. The following statements compare Gallaudet University and NewU University with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Gallaudet's tuition ($18,382) is more expensive than NewU ($16,500).
  • Gallaudet's acceptance rate (59.21%) is lower than NewU (90.41%).
  • Gallaudet has higher yield (71.56%) than NewU (2.42%).
  • Both schools have same SAT scores of 855.
  • NewU's students to faculty ratio (4 to 1) is lower than Gallaudet (6 to 1).
  • Gallaudet (1,322 students) is larger than NewU (18 students) with more enrolled students.
